Base | The factor multiplied by itself to evaluate an exponent.

Exponent | The number of times the base is multiplied. The tiny number written with the base.

Squared | A number that has an exponent of 2. Second power.

Cubed | A number with an exponent of 3. Third power.

Equation | A math sentence with an equals sign.

Prime Number | A number with exactly 2 factors. Example: 7 = 7x1; this is the only way to make 7 using whole numbers and multiplication.

Composite Numbers | A number with more than 2 factors. Example: 25 = 5x5 and 25 = 25x1. 25 is composite because it has 3 factors, 5, 25 and 1.
